Water Consumption & Industrial Process Waste

Effective building design, construction and management can deliver major savings in water use and the associated costs of energy, water supply and waste water treatment. This can be achieved without compromising the performance. A proactive approach to water efficiency needs to exert influence over: GRCCC follows the design specifications applied to new construction (providing the potential); and the way in which a building is used, managed and maintained. A good option is to prepare a Water Efficiency Strategy which sets out a proposed approach to quantifying the performance that will be achieved relative to industry benchmarks.

GRCCC always adapt principles of water efficiency and follow these principles:

  • Monitor and manage our current system, both to ensure equipment is performing to its full potential and to encourage responsible use;
  • Reduce use by using water-efficient technologies, fixing leaks, and influencing user behaviour;
  • Minimise water heating by using efficient heating, storage and distribution systems; and
  • Replace potable water with grey or rain water where practicable.
